Adelaides Shane Ellen was the best he ever played he kicked 5 and although he played some time at full forward in that game he kicked most of the goals playing of the HBF in that game, Blighty definetly had a huge influence on that game with the use of Ellen, but Ellen had to execute it and did

Good call. He basically won the game for the Hawks with his 4 goals in the last Q. Keddie twice won the BnF in his career at Hawthorn, so he must have played quite a number of great games -but that last Q in the'71 GF is why he is remembered.
He worked in coaching and footy admin after he finished playing. He was the responsible for establishing the Vickick /Auskick program.
